Where is Place de la Concorde Located?

The Place de la Concorde is located between the Jardin des Tuileries, the gardens of the Louvre, and the Avenue des Champs-Élysées, the famous shopping and Grand Boulevard. With an area of 68,470 m2, it is the largest square in Paris and the second largest in France.

The Place de la Concorde was built between 1755 and 1776 by order of King Louis XV. Its original Name was place Louis XV and at the centre of the square at that time was an equestrian statue of the King. During the riots of the French Revolution, the Statue was replaced by a statue of liberty and the Square was renamed Place de la Révolution. In 1793, the famous Guillotine was installed here, on which King Louis XVI and Queen Marie Antoinette were publicly executed, as well as another 1117 people. With the end of the revolutionary period, the Square got its current name Place de la Concorde.
